Heritage Place
Last Updated: 2/1/2024
Legal Business Name | CENTRAL PENINSULA GENERAL HOSPITAL INC |
Affiliated Entity | |
Region | West |
Address | 232 ROCKWELL AVENUE, Soldotna, Alaska 99669 |
County | Kenai Peninsula County |
Phone | 9072622545 |
CMS Certification Number CCN | 025021 |
Owership Type | Non profit - Corporation |
Nurse Hours Per Resident Per Day | 5.9217 |
Health Survey Score | 54.667 |
Reported Incidents | 4 |
Number of Complaints | 1 |
Infection Control Citations | 0.0 |
Number of Fines | 0 |
Amount of Fines | $0.0 |
Payment Denials | 0 |
Facility Rating Comparisons (Scale 1-5)
Rating Type | Provider | State | Region | National |
---|---|---|---|---|
Overall Rating | 5.0 | 3.6 | 3.2 | 2.87 |
Health | 3.0 | - | - | - |
Quality | 5.0 | 3.9 | 4.1 | 3.5 |
Short-Stay | 5.0 | - | - | - |
Long-Stay | 5.0 | - | - | - |
Turnover % | 38.8% | 48.8% | 50.1% | 52.72% |
Staffing | 5.0 | 4.4 | 3.2 | 2.7 |

Staffing Rating
Staffing is a vital aspect to consider when evaluating nursing homes, and the staffing rating for Heritage Place is exceptionally high at 5.0, which surpasses both the state and national averages by 14% and 85%, respectively. This indicates that Heritage Place maintains a robust workforce to cater to the needs of its residents. A high staffing rating often translates to improved quality of care, as more staff members equate to better attention and assistance for residents. When researching nursing homes, a strong staffing rating like the one at Heritage Place can provide assurance to families seeking a supportive environment for their loved ones. In terms of turnover, Heritage Place boasts a notably low total nursing staff turnover rate of 38.8%, which is 20% lower than the state average and 26% lower than the national average. Low turnover rates are generally viewed as positive within the healthcare industry, as they suggest staff members are content in their roles and are more likely to provide consistent care over time. A low turnover rate can lead to better continuity of care for residents, as familiar faces among staff members can contribute to a sense of stability and trust. Evaluating nursing homes based on turnover rates can offer insights into staff satisfaction and the overall work environment, highlighting facilities like Heritage Place that prioritize staff retention and cultivate a supportive workplace culture.
